About

Thinking Machines Lab is an AI research startup founded in February 2025 by Mira Murati, former CTO of OpenAI. It raised $2 billion at a $12 billion valuation from Andreessen Horowitz, Nvidia, AMD, and Jane Street, and signed a multi-year compute deal with Nvidia for Vera Rubin systems starting in 2027.

About

Ricursive Intelligence is a Palo Alto-based frontier AI lab founded in 2025 by Dr. Anna Goldie and Dr. Azalia Mirhoseini, creators of AlphaChip at Google DeepMind. It raised $335M at a $4B valuation from Sequoia, Lightspeed, and Nvidia to build AI that designs next-generation semiconductor chips.
